A book for those who love woodwork, written for those wanting to pursue this as a craft but are limited on space and wish to avoid the noise of machines. There is great pleasure and satisfaction from producing pieces using your skill with hand tools, whilst working in a small shed or garage.

In a straightforward, engaging style, Vic Tesolin shows how to make the most of a smaller workspace and only a modest selection of hand tools. The book starts with an overview of the essential tools needed to take on virtually every woodworking project. Scattered throughout the book are hints and tips. Later chapters feature detailed plans and instructions on how to build several workshop fixtures and accessories. Each project helps develop your skills, at the same time adding another useful item to your workshop.
